初学者也能轻松掌握的VPS构建方法
一、引言
随着互联网技术的飞速发展,越来越多的个人和企业需要搭建自己的服务器来承载网站、应用或服务。
虚拟专用服务器(VPS)作为一种经济实惠且灵活的选择,备受青睐。
但对于初学者来说,VPS构建可能显得复杂而令人望而却步。
本文将介绍初学者如何轻松掌握VPS构建方法,从准备工作到实际操作,一步步带你走进VPS构建的奇妙世界。
二、准备工作
1. 了解基础知识:在构建VPS之前,你需要了解一些基础知识,如操作系统(如Linux、Windows)、虚拟化技术(如KVM、VMware)、云服务平台(如阿里云、腾讯云)等。
2. 选择云服务平台:选择一个可信赖的云服务平台是构建VPS的第一步。初学者可以选择一些提供丰富教程和良好客户支持的云服务提供商。
3. 准备资金:构建VPS需要一定的资金投入,包括服务器租赁费用、域名费用等。初学者可以根据自己的需求预算资金。
三、选购VPS
1. 选择配置:根据实际需求选择合适的VPS配置,如CPU、内存、硬盘空间、带宽等。
2. 选择操作系统:根据你的需求选择合适的操作系统,如Linux或Windows。
3. 购买VPS:在云服务平台购买VPS,完成支付后,你将获得服务器的远程访问权限。
四、安装与配置
1. 远程访问VPS:通过远程桌面连接(Windows)或SSH客户端(Linux)访问你的VPS。
2. 安装操作系统:按照云服务提供商提供的教程安装操作系统。这一步通常需要设置用户名、密码、时区等。
3. 配置网络:配置服务器的网络设置,包括IP地址、DNS设置等。
4. 安装必要的软件:根据你的需求安装必要的软件,如Web服务器(如Apache、Nginx)、数据库(如MySQL、PostgreSQL)等。
五、安全设置
1. 设置强密码:为你的VPS设置一个强密码,以增加安全性。
2. 防火墙设置:安装并配置防火墙,以阻止未经授权的访问。
3. 定期备份:定期备份重要数据,以防数据丢失。
4. 安全更新:定期更新操作系统和应用程序,以修复可能的安全漏洞。
六、部署应用或服务
1. 部署网站:通过FTP或面板上传网站文件,配置服务器以运行你的网站。
2. 配置邮件服务:如果你需要邮件服务,可以在服务器上安装和配置邮件服务器软件。
3. 其他服务:你可以根据自己的需求在服务器上部署其他应用或服务,如数据库、FTP服务器、VPN等。
七、监控与维护
1. 监控服务器状态:定期检查服务器的硬件和软件状态,确保服务器正常运行。
2. 性能优化:根据服务器性能进行优化,以提高服务器响应速度和稳定性。
3. 解决问题:在遇到问题时,可以通过查阅文档、搜索解决方案或寻求社区帮助来解决问题。
八、总结
本文介绍了初学者如何轻松掌握VPS构建方法,从准备工作到实际操作,一步步带你走进VPS构建的奇妙世界。
通过遵循本文的指导,你可以轻松构建自己的VPS并部署应用或服务。
当然,VPS构建与管理是一个长期的过程,需要不断学习和实践。
希望本文能为初学者提供有益的参考和帮助。
九、附加建议
1. 学习基础知识:除了本文介绍的内容,建议你深入学习服务器管理、网络安全、Linux命令等方面的知识,这将有助于你更好地管理和维护你的VPS。
2. 参与社区交流:加入相关的技术社区或论坛,与其他开发者交流经验,共同解决问题。
3. 不断实践:实践是掌握技能的最好方法。通过不断实践,你将逐渐熟悉VPS构建与管理的过程。
4. 关注新技术:关注云计算、虚拟化等领域的最新技术,以便更好地优化你的VPS。
十、结束语
希望通过本文的介绍,初学者能够轻松掌握VPS构建方法,成功搭建自己的服务器。
请记住,学习新技能需要时间和实践。
不断努力学习,你将逐渐成为一名优秀的服务器管理员。
暂无评论内容